centOS安装配置go1.18环境

发布时间 2023-09-09 18:34:20作者: shui00cc

今天在centOS系统宝塔面板下创建Go项目,打算安装Go环境。

Gin、Gorm中的一些新语言特性似乎要求go1.18及以上,因此我安装并记录下了以下配置过程。

  • 卸载原有旧版本(没有则不做)

sudo rm -rf /usr/local/go

  • 下载go对应版本二进制包

wget https://studygolang.com/dl/golang/go1.18.3.linux-amd64.tar.gz

  • 解压到对应路径

sudo tar zxvf go1.18.3.linux-amd64.tar.gz -C /usr/local

  • 添加配置

打开/etc/profile文件 添加以下
export GO111MODULE=on
export GOROOT=/usr/local/go
export GOPATH=/home/gopath
export PATH=$PATH:$GOROOT/bin:$GOPATH/bin
export GOPROXY=https://goproxy.io,direct

 

ps:以上过程中我的路径是/usr/local,如果是/usr/bin或其他路径根据自己情况修改;安装的版本包根据自己情况修改,注意 go1.x 是比 go1.1x 旧的版本